wac1 Posted June 20, 2010 Share I have just fitted a carbon bar onto my mongoose teocali . Not only for the weight but they are shorter They measure 620mm and the old one were 660mm. I did a race on Wednesday and found that the bike was much more controlable , especialy through fast corners , Thick sand and climbing rocks . Any one else notice a difference from shorter bars or do i Just feel better becasue they look better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
stewie911 Posted June 20, 2010 Share This topic has been widely discussed on the hub. A shorter handlebar definately makes a difference. It will be more responsive. The bike will now turn sharper with less "hand travel" on the handlebar.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
